Ball gown/prom dress in Delhi

Hello,

This is perhaps more for the Delhi-ites out there. I'm looking for a real fancy dress, western style prom dress or ball gown. Ideally not a lengha or materila for stitching, or anything way OTT, as many Indian styles tend to be.
I've seen some lovely fabric, but want to TRY ON, before buying to check it's right and suits me etce tc.

So, Can anyone recommend a good boutique in Delhi where they have ready made ball gowns?

I've searched well online, but not found anything so far that corresponds. SInce my stay will be short lived, I'd love to hear from anyon else's experience.

Thank you!

I hope I'm not too late with this, but there's a store called Chamomile in greater kailash part 1..a bit expensive, but it'll have exactly what you're looking for. It has dresses by Indian designers. Then there's the Mango store in South Extension..always a safe bet for a dress, cheaper than the Indian stores too. Or you could do a recce of the stores in Khan market..many of them will have what you're looking for. Happy shopping

There is a shop on Janpath near the Gov't Cottage Industries, just opposite the McDonalds and down towards Connaught Place a bit... it is a shop that sells beaded ball gowns for like 1500 rupees! They have gorgeous dresses there, I bought one for myself but still havent' had the chance to wear it...
